Founded in 2021, Pulsora the “Enterprise Sustainability Platform”, is a well-funded Silicon Valley software startup.  It is dedicated to empowering purpose-driven enterprises to manage and improve their environmental, social, and governance (ESG) and overall sustainability footprint with an integrated, comprehensive, flexible, and innovative technology platform built for compliance, tracking, and insight. About the job

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ced AI/ML Developer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be a specialist in the rapidly evolving field of Large Language Models (LLMs) and generative AI, with a strong background in developing, integrating, and optimizing complex agentic and RAG-based systems.

What you will do
  • LLM Integration & Development: Design, develop, and deploy production-grade applications leveraging various LLMs, context optimization, etc.

  • Agentic Workflows: Architect and implement sophisticated, multi-step and multi-agent workflows using frameworks like LangChain and LangGraph.

  • Retrieval Augmented Generation (RAG): Build and optimize RAG pipelines, including implementing and managing embeddings, vector databases, and advanced rerankers to enhance response quality and relevance.

  • Vibe Coding: Use code generation applications (e.g. Replit, Cursor, Google AI Studio, Git Hub Copilot in Agent mode, etc.) to create full applications (including frontend and backend), generate tests, perform testing and integrate them in the core product without writing any code.

  • LLM Fine Tuning: Lead efforts in LLM fine-tuning (e.g., LoRA, QLoRA) for specific domain knowledge and tasks, and implement strategies for and efficiency.

  • Prompt Engineering: Develop and refine advanced prompt engineering techniques to maximize model performance, consistency, and safety.

  • Full-Stack Development: Own end-to-end implementation from frontend to the backend.

  • Java (Plus): Expose AI/LLM functionality written in Python using Java services, leverage multi-threading capabilities in Java to augment AI/LLM functionality developed in Python

  • Code Quality & Productivity: Utilize AI-powered development t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, etc.) to efficiently generate, refactor, and optimize high-quality code.

  • Collaboration: Work closely with team leads managers, QA, product managers and team in the US (this will require the willingness to partially work US working hours)

About you
  • Undergraduate degree in Computer Science or similar Engineering field, advanced degree is a plus

  • 5+ years of professional experience in software development, with a minimum of 2 years focused on AI/ML development, particularly with LLMs

  • Strong proficiency in Python and its relevant data science libraries (e.g., Pandas, NumPy, Scikit-learn)

  • Proven experience integrating and working with major LLM APIs - both public and private/local, e.g., Gemini, OpenAI, Anthropic, Llama, Ollama, etc., including hands-on experience using techniques for LLM efficiency

  • At least 1 year of deep practical experience with LangChain and LangGraph for building complex LLM applications and agentic workflows using autonomous agents, tools, memory management, parallelization, etc.

  • Solid understanding and implementation experience with RAG architectures, vector DBs, vector search, embeddings, and reranking mechanisms

  • Experience leveraging AI Copilot or similar generative AI coding tools for accelerated development, code generation, refactoring, optimization, and vibe coding to create integrated backend and frontend applications

  • Experience creating UI using React and integrating the UI with the backend using REST APIs is a big plus

  • Hands-on experience with Java, especially integrating Java modules with Python modules is a nice to have, but not necessary

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
